▎ 摘 要
NOVELTY - The stacked electrode comprises a multi-layered graphene film (14) and a metal wiring (15). The metal wiring contains randomly oriented metal nanowires having an average diameter of 30-150 nm. The multi-layered graphene film contains a laminate of graphene sheets (12, 13), which contain an aggregate of graphene plates (11). The multi-layered graphene film has a thickness of less than or equal to 5 nm. The stacked electrode is coated with a near-infrared transparent resin. USE - The stacked electrode is useful in a photoelectric conversion device (claimed), a display device or a solar cell. ADVANTAGE - The stacked electrode can be economically manufactured with improved electrical conductivity and transmittance and increased surface resistance and without vacuum processes, and improves light output efficiency of the display device and energy conversion efficiency of the solar cell.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- The stacked electrode comprises a multi-layered graphene film (14) and a metal wiring (15). The metal wiring contains randomly oriented metal nanowires having an average diameter of 30-150 nm. The multi-layered graphene film contains a laminate of graphene sheets (12, 13), which contain an aggregate of graphene plates (11). The graphene plates have an average area of 3(A+B)2 nm2 or more, where A (nm) represents the average diameter of the metal nanowires, B (nm) satisfies the equation of B2/(A+B)2=(1-X), and X represents the ratio of the area of the metal nanowires projected in a stacking direction of the stacked electrode. The multi-layered graphene film has a thickness of less than or equal to 5 nm. The stacked electrode is coated with a near-infrared transparent resin. INDEPENDENT CLAIMS are included for: (1) a method for producing a stacked electrode; and (2) a photoelectric conversion device. DESCRIPTION OF DRAWING(S) - The diagram shows a schematic view of a stacked electrode. Graphene plates (11) Graphene sheets (12, 13) Multi-layered graphene film (14) Metal wiring. (15)
